Private Key Resilience, within the context of cryptocurrency, options trading, and financial derivatives, fundamentally concerns the ability of a cryptographic key to maintain its integrity and usability despite potential threats. This encompasses protection against loss, theft, corruption, or unauthorized access, ensuring continued control over associated assets and contractual rights. Robust key resilience is paramount for secure operations, particularly as derivative instruments increasingly leverage blockchain technology and decentralized protocols. The design and implementation of resilient key management systems are therefore critical components of risk mitigation strategies.
Architecture
The architectural design of private key resilience solutions varies significantly depending on the specific application and threat model. Hierarchical deterministic (HD) wallets, for instance, offer a degree of resilience through seed phrase backups, allowing key recovery even if a single key is compromised. Multi-signature schemes require multiple approvals for transactions, reducing the risk of single-point failures. Furthermore, hardware security modules (HSMs) and secure enclaves provide tamper-resistant environments for key storage and cryptographic operations, bolstering overall system security.
Algorithm
Underlying private key resilience are sophisticated cryptographic algorithms and protocols. Elliptic Curve Cryptography (ECC) remains a dominant choice for key generation and digital signatures, but ongoing research explores post-quantum cryptography to address potential vulnerabilities from future quantum computers. Key derivation functions (KDFs) are employed to generate multiple keys from a single seed, enhancing security through diversification. The selection and implementation of these algorithms must adhere to rigorous security standards and best practices to ensure effective protection against evolving threats.